Withdrawing 3000 from M-Pesa: A Guide to Your Frequently Asked Questions

M-Pesa is one of the most popular mobile money services in Kenya, providing users with a convenient way to send and receive money, pay bills, and make purchases. However, when it comes to withdrawing large amounts, users may have questions about the process and any potential fees involved.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much is withdrawing 3000 from M-Pesa?

The withdrawal fee for withdrawing 3000 from M-Pesa is KES 30. However, please note that this fee may be subject to change, and you should always check the official Safaricom website or your M-Pesa app for the most up-to-date information. It’s also worth noting that you may need to have sufficient balance in your M-Pesa account to cover the withdrawal fee.

Can I withdraw more than 3000 from M-Pesa at once?

Yes, you can withdraw more than 3000 from M-Pesa at once, but you may be subject to certain limits and requirements. For example, you may need to have a Safaricom postpaid or prepaid plan, and you may need to complete a verification process to increase your daily withdrawal limit. It’s always best to check with Safaricom customer support or your M-Pesa app for the most up-to-date information.

How long does it take to withdraw 3000 from M-Pesa?

The time it takes to withdraw 3000 from M-Pesa can vary depending on the method of withdrawal and the availability of cash at the agent or ATM. Typically, withdrawals are processed instantly, but it may take a few minutes for the cash to be dispensed.
